Exciting news from Cosmic Ray’s Starlight Cafe at Magic Kingdom—they've introduced some fresh menu items! We dropped by to give them a taste. While Cosmic Ray’s usually isn't our top pick at Magic Kingdom, we're always up for new Disney culinary adventures.
First off, we tried the Hand-dipped Fried Chicken Sandwich for $13.19. Featuring a chicken breast with honey mustard sauce and pickles on a brioche bun, plus fries on the side, it was decent but nothing extraordinary. The chicken was juicy and well-cooked, but the flavors were a bit muted, with the pickles being the standout taste.
Next, the Classic Ranch Salad with Grilled Chicken for $11.99 was fresh and crisp, perfect for a lighter option. The grilled chicken was juicy, and the salad ingredients were vibrant and crunchy, though nothing particularly stood out flavor-wise.
Lastly, the Truffle-French Onion Burger stole the show at $14.99, featuring an Angus beef patty with braised beef-caramelized onion confit, Swiss cheese, parmesan, crispy onions, and a black garlic-truffle aїoli. It was delicious and packed with satisfying flavors. This burger was definitely the winner for us!
